Trico Electric Co-op responded to a power outage around Corona de Tucson at 1:30 p.m. Power was restored at 2:26 p.m. after about 1,000 customers were without electricity.

TUCSON, Ariz. — Trico Electric Co-op responded to a power outage around Corona de Tucson at 1:30 p.m.The cause of the outage was due to an animal coming into contact with equipment.
